Lahore Qalandars face Multan Sultans at Gaddafi Stadium in PSL 2026 Match 11, with Qalandars weakened by Fakhar Zaman's two-match suspension for ball-tampering—appeal rejected April 2—depriving them of a top-order aggressor after their mixed start (one dominant win over Hyderabad Kingsmen, one loss to Karachi Kings). Sultans arrive unbeaten with two victories, topping points table on net run rate, bolstered by overseas arrivals like Steve Smith and Ashton Turner (captain). Batting-friendly pitch favors high scores and chasing under lights; toss could prove pivotal amid competitive head-to-head history. Key watch: Sultans' bowling depth versus Qalandars' pace attack led by Shaheen Afridi.

This market resolves according to the finalized match result as published by https://www.espncricinfo.com/.
DLS/DRS, over-rate penalties, forfeit/walkover, or any other on-field ruling that leads the competition to declare a winner are treated as ordinary wins.
If the match ends tied and the playing conditions provide an on-field tiebreak (e.g., Super Over), the winner determined by that tiebreak will be used for resolution. If the match ends tied and no on-field tiebreak is used or available under the playing conditions (e.g., group-stage ODI with no Super Over), the market will resolve 50-50.
If the match is postponed/rescheduled, the market remains open until the listed fixture is completed. If the match is permanently canceled or abandoned or otherwise is completed without a winner, the market resolves 50-50.
The primary resolution source for this market is the official statistics of the event as recognized by the governing body or event organizers. However, if the governing body or event organizers have not published final match statistics within 2 hours after the event's con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ead.
